The 11th Annual Webby Awards in June will feature a new category for mobile. Presented by dotMobi, the new category will honor sites designed for mobile devices.
The new Webby Mobile Awards will feature three categories: Listings , Updates, News and Entertainment, and Mobile Marketplace, which will honor sites selling products and services. The deadline for entries is Dec. 15, 2006. Nominees will be announced in April.To enter a site in The Webby Mobile Awards, visit www.webbyawards.com.

Acquisition Adds 1.8 Million Domain Names to Industry’s Leading Premium Resale Marketplace
WALTHAM, Mass.–(BUSINESS WIRE)–NameMedia, the industry leader in Direct Search and Premium Domain Name Sales, today announced that is has acquired Afternic, Inc., the industry’s pioneer marketplace for the resale of domain names. Afternic will join with BuyDomains, NameMedia’s existing domain name marketplace, in creating the leading platform for the domain aftermarket.
